键值存储在实时数据处理中的作用

发布时间:2025-03-28 06:45:57 作者:小樊
来源:亿速云 阅读:97

键值存储在实时数据处理中扮演着至关重要的角色。以下是键值存储在实时数据处理中的主要作用:

数据存储与检索

  1. 高效的数据访问

    • 键值存储系统通常提供非常快速的读写操作,这对于需要快速响应的实时应用至关重要。
  2. 简单的数据模型

    • 键值对的结构使得数据的存储和检索变得直观且易于实现。
  3. 可扩展性

    • 许多键值数据库设计用于水平扩展,能够处理大量数据和高并发请求。
  4. 灵活性

    • 可以存储各种类型的数据,包括结构化、半结构化和非结构化数据。

实时数据处理的优势

  1. 低延迟

    • 由于键值存储的高效性,数据处理和分析可以在毫秒级甚至亚毫秒级完成。
  2. 事件驱动架构

    • 适合构建事件驱动的应用程序,其中数据的产生和处理是紧密耦合的。
  3. 实时分析

    • 能够支持对流入数据的即时分析和聚合,提供实时的业务洞察。
  4. 容错性和持久性

    • 大多数键值存储系统提供了数据备份和恢复机制,确保数据的可靠性和持久性。
  5. 简化应用逻辑

    • 开发者可以专注于业务逻辑而不是底层的数据管理,从而加快开发速度。

应用场景举例

技术选型建议

在选择键值存储解决方案时,应考虑以下因素:

注意事项

综上所述,合理利用键值存储可以显著提升实时数据处理系统的效率和响应能力。

推荐阅读:
  1. Python爬虫如何获取数据并保存到数据库中
  2. Python怎么封装数据库连接池

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

数据库

上一篇:Python正则表达式怎样写

下一篇:键值存储如何处理数据一致性问题

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》